ACCOUNT 793
PRACTICUM IN PROFESSIONAL ACCOUNTANCY Repeatable
University of Wisconsin-Whitewater · UGRD · Fall 2026
1 section
Catalog description
This course provides students, under the direction of a faculty advisor, the opportunity to apply their theoretical backgrounds in settings ranging from internships in accounting organizations to other approved activities related to the practice of professional accountancy. A learning contract will be developed by the faculty advisor, professional supervisor (if applicable), and student that clearly delineates the expectations and responsibilities. PREREQ: ACCOUNT 343 WITH A GRADE OF "C" OR BETTER, OR EQUIVALENT; MUST BE ADMITTED TO A COBE GRADUATE DEGREE PROGRAM; HAVE DEPARTMENT CONSENT
